@njr-11 njr-11 commented Oct 21, 2025

While reviewing #222 in order to learn about how this will integrate with the Jakarta Connector specification, I noticed ambiguous wording in the setReadOnly method Javadoc that makes it unclear whether the new read-only applies to a transaction that was just started on the thread or only to subsequent transactions that are started after that point. I posted a comment to the PR. The author replied to point out that the intended meaning is the latter, but indicated he had copied the pattern for the wording from the setTransactionTimeout method and would not be updating it under the PR (which was impossible anyway because the PR was already merged). Another participant asked me to submit a PR with proposed unambiguous wording for the methods. That is attempted under this PR.
